The National at Showbox

Their last record was better, but this year's The Boxer earned the National their place as band of choice for the rueful, aging rocker set. Soaked in bourbon and melancholy, the songs on The Boxer are about avoidance: avoiding adulthood, avoiding isolation, avoiding the real world and its wars between nations and between lovers. With his distinctive, haunting baritone, singer Matt Berninger leads what's essentially an intellectual bar band that even your coworkers who shop at Pottery Barn would like. (Showbox at the Market, 1426 First Ave, 628-3151. 8 pm, $15 adv/$18 DOS, all ages.)
